Holland & Hart last week notified Congress that it is advocating for Europe's second largest automaker.
The law firm is representing Paris-based PSA Peugeot Citroën on "[i]nternational trade issues affecting Foreign Automobile Manufacturers," according to a lobbying registration filing submitted on Friday. Holland & Hart partners Kelly Johnson and J. Triplett Mackintosh are handling the account.
Johnson declined to elaborate on the filing.
The French car manufacturer hasn't had lobbyists register to represent it before, according to congressional records that date to 1999.
